Question
the number of hits that a web site receives in 10 days is as follows: 45, 48, 25, 37, 40, 32, 25, 41, 38, 29 find the standard deviation for this data. 6.6 7.6 8.0 64.0
Step1: Calculate the mean
The formula for the mean \(\bar{x}=\frac{\sum_{i = 1}^{n}x_{i}}{n}\).
Here \(n = 10\), \(x=\{45,48,25,37,40,32,25,41,38,29\}\)
\(\sum_{i=1}^{10}x_{i}=45 + 48+25+37+40+32+25+41+38+29=360\)
\(\bar{x}=\frac{360}{10}=36\)
Step2: Calculate the variance
The formula for the variance \(s^{2}=\frac{\sum_{i = 1}^{n}(x_{i}-\bar{x})^{2}}{n - 1}\)
\((x_{1}-\bar{x})^{2}=(45 - 36)^{2}=81\)
\((x_{2}-\bar{x})^{2}=(48 - 36)^{2}=144\)
\((x_{3}-\bar{x})^{2}=(25 - 36)^{2}=121\)
\((x_{4}-\bar{x})^{2}=(37 - 36)^{2}=1\)
\((x_{5}-\bar{x})^{2}=(40 - 36)^{2}=16\)
\((x_{6}-\bar{x})^{2}=(32 - 36)^{2}=16\)
\((x_{7}-\bar{x})^{2}=(25 - 36)^{2}=121\)
\((x_{8}-\bar{x})^{2}=(41 - 36)^{2}=25\)
\((x_{9}-\bar{x})^{2}=(38 - 36)^{2}=4\)
\((x_{10}-\bar{x})^{2}=(29 - 36)^{2}=49\)
\(\sum_{i = 1}^{10}(x_{i}-\bar{x})^{2}=81+144 + 121+1+16+16+121+25+4+49=578\)
\(s^{2}=\frac{578}{9}\approx64.22\)
Step3: Calculate the standard deviation
The formula for the standard deviation \(s=\sqrt{s^{2}}\)
\(s=\sqrt{\frac{578}{9}}\approx\sqrt{64.22}\approx8.0\)
